Just for the record, you can be an artist(and get paid) without the "fine arts" degree. It's called raw talent and work ethic. If you really have what it takes to sell a piece of art, no one will look at your degree before they purchase it.
And don't believe the term "starving artist". Look within your 5 ft radius. Unless you're sitting on a log in the wilderness, you'll see art which was created by paid artists.... whether it's a calendar on your wall, the tshirt design you're wearing or the label on the jar of mayonnaise you just pulled out of the fridge. I've been living as an artist for 20 years and by this time I've built up many streams of income which pay me perpetually.
